¬<><∪∪には、Ant用のタスクが含まれています。クラス名は、jp.gr.java_conf.koto.notavacc.AntTaskです。Apache Ant version 1.6.5 compiled on June 2 2005 で動作確認されています。
| 属性 | 説明 | 必須? |
|---|---|---|
srcdir |
--source-path で指定される、¬<><∪∪ソースの存在するディレクトリ。 |
Yes |
destdir |
--destination-path で指定される、Javaソースファイルが出力されるディレクトリ |
No |
上記に加えて、FileSetと同様の属性をサポートし、コンパイル対象のファイルを指定することができます。ただし、dir属性の代わりにsrcdir属性を使用します。
| 要素 | 説明 | 必須? |
|---|---|---|
Arg |
¬<><∪∪に渡されるコマンドライン引数を指定します。この要素は、Command-line Argumentsに説明される属性を持ちます。この要素を利用して、--source-path、--destination-path、処理されるファイル名を渡すことはできません。 |
No |
上記に加えて、FileSetと同様の要素をサポートします。
<taskdef name="notavacc" classname="jp.gr.java_conf.koto.notavacc.AntTask" /> <notavacc srcdir="src" destdir="dst"> <arg value="-v" /> <arg value="--target" /> <arg value="1.4" /> </notavacc>
src ディレクトリにある **/*.notavacc ファイルをコンパイルし、dst ディレクトリへ出力します。-v オプションにより、処理経過の詳細を表示します。--targetオプションにより、Java1.4にマッチした出力を行います。